1. The problem is to construct the bisector of \(\angle DEF\).\n\n2. The angle bisector divides the angle into two equal parts. To construct it, use a compass to draw arcs from vertex \(E\) intersecting both rays \(ED\) and \(EF\).\n\n3. Mark the intersection points as \(X\) on \(ED\) and \(Y\) on \(EF\).\n\n4. With the same compass width, draw arcs from points \(X\) and \(Y\) so that these arcs intersect each other. Label the intersection as \(Z\).\n\n5. Draw a straight line from vertex \(E\) through point \(Z\). This line is the bisector of \(\angle DEF\).\n\nThis construction ensures the angle is split into two congruent angles by the bisector line.\n
